数据库除法指令是什么

fiy 其他 4

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在数据库中,除法指令用于从一个表中筛选出符合条件的数据,并且这些数据也存在于另一个表中。数据库除法指令通常由SQL语言提供,其语法和用法可能会有所不同,具体取决于使用的数据库管理系统。以下是一些常见数据库管理系统中的除法指令示例:

    1. MySQL:

      SELECT column_name(s)
      FROM table1
      WHERE column_name IN (
          SELECT column_name
          FROM table2
      )
      

      该语句将从table1表中选择符合条件的数据,条件是这些数据也存在于table2表中。

    2. Oracle:

      SELECT column_name(s)
      FROM table1
      WHERE EXISTS (
          SELECT column_name
          FROM table2
          WHERE table1.column_name = table2.column_name
      )
      

      该语句将从table1表中选择符合条件的数据,条件是这些数据也存在于table2表中。

    3. SQL Server:

      SELECT column_name(s)
      FROM table1
      WHERE column_name IN (
          SELECT column_name
          FROM table2
      )
      

      该语句将从table1表中选择符合条件的数据,条件是这些数据也存在于table2表中。

    4. PostgreSQL:

      SELECT column_name(s)
      FROM table1
      WHERE EXISTS (
          SELECT column_name
          FROM table2
          WHERE table1.column_name = table2.column_name
      )
      

      该语句将从table1表中选择符合条件的数据,条件是这些数据也存在于table2表中。

    5. SQLite:

      SELECT column_name(s)
      FROM table1
      WHERE column_name IN (
          SELECT column_name
          FROM table2
      )
      

      该语句将从table1表中选择符合条件的数据,条件是这些数据也存在于table2表中。

    需要注意的是,不同的数据库管理系统可能会有不同的除法指令语法和用法,以上示例仅为常见的示例,具体使用时应根据所使用的数据库管理系统的文档进行查询和参考。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库中的除法指令是用来进行除法运算的操作指令。在关系型数据库中,常用的除法指令是"DIVIDE"。

    "DIVIDE"指令用于从一个表中除去另一个表,并返回除法操作的结果。它可以用来解决一些特定的查询问题,例如查找满足某些条件的记录。

    通常,"DIVIDE"指令的语法如下:

    SELECT column_list
    FROM table1
    DIVIDE
    SELECT column_list
    FROM table2
    WHERE condition;

    其中,column_list表示需要查询的列名,table1和table2分别表示需要进行除法操作的两个表,condition表示除法操作的条件。

    使用"DIVIDE"指令时,数据库会先将table1和table2中的数据进行匹配,然后对匹配的结果进行除法操作,最后返回除法操作的结果。这样,我们可以得到满足条件的记录。

    需要注意的是,除法操作是一种相对复杂的操作,需要在数据库中有一定的基础知识和经验。在实际应用中,可以根据具体的需求和数据结构,合理运用除法指令来解决问题。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库中的除法操作可以使用SQL语言中的除法指令实现。在SQL中,除法操作主要通过使用"DIV"运算符或者使用" / "符号实现。下面将从方法和操作流程两个方面讲解数据库中的除法操作。

    1. 使用DIV运算符进行除法操作:
      DIV运算符是SQL中用来执行整数除法的运算符。它可以将两个数相除并返回结果的整数部分。以下是使用DIV运算符进行除法操作的基本语法:

      dividend DIV divisor
      

      其中,dividend是被除数,divisor是除数。DIV运算符会将被除数除以除数,并返回结果的整数部分。

    2. 使用/运算符进行除法操作:
      除法操作也可以使用"/"符号实现。该符号会将两个数相除并返回结果的小数部分。以下是使用"/"符号进行除法操作的基本语法:

      dividend / divisor
      

      其中,dividend是被除数,divisor是除数。"/"运算符会将被除数除以除数,并返回结果的小数部分。

    下面是一个使用DIV运算符和/运算符进行除法操作的示例:

    假设有一个名为"employees"的表,其中包含员工的工资和职位等信息。现在要计算所有员工的平均工资。

    SELECT SUM(salary) DIV COUNT(*) AS average_salary
    FROM employees;
    

    以上示例中,使用DIV运算符将所有员工的工资总和除以员工总数,得到平均工资的整数部分。

    SELECT SUM(salary) / COUNT(*) AS average_salary
    FROM employees;
    

    以上示例中,使用"/"运算符将所有员工的工资总和除以员工总数,得到平均工资的小数部分。

    综上所述,数据库中的除法操作可以通过使用DIV运算符或者"/"符号实现。使用DIV运算符可以得到结果的整数部分,而使用"/"符号可以得到结果的小数部分。具体使用哪种方法取决于需要的结果类型。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部